Shania Twain – Come On Over: A Timeless Invitation to Joy and Celebration
When we think about the essence of country-pop, few artists have managed to define and refine the genre as successfully as Shania Twain. Her 1997 hit Come On Over is not just a song; it’s a celebration of life, love, and the energy that music can bring to any room. A song that has withstood the test of time, Come On Over invites us into a world where the spirit of country twirls gracefully with the infectious rhythms of pop, creating an unforgettable, feel-good anthem.
The lyrics of Come On Over are simple, yet profoundly impactful. They tell the story of a woman offering an open invitation for someone to join her, with all the warmth and joy of a friendly gathering. It’s a song that radiates positivity and connection, with an undercurrent of warmth that invites everyone to step out of their own world and come into hers. The melodic structure of the song is cleverly crafted to evoke both the familiar comfort of country music and the vibrant energy of pop, blending these two distinct worlds in a way that feels natural and effortless.
Shania Twain’s voice, with its unique ability to convey both strength and softness, plays a pivotal role in this track. She commands the stage with confidence, yet there’s an intimacy in her tone that makes the listener feel personally invited into the conversation. The playful energy that she exudes throughout the song is contagious, and it quickly becomes clear why Come On Over became one of her signature songs.
